Maximum input is 24,500 BTU/hr for natural gas and propane.
Maximum output for natural gas and propane is 20,825 BTU/hr
at an efficiency of 85% with the fan on. The maximum A.F.U.E.
(annual fuel utilization efficiency) rating is 82%. This fireplace
insert is not approved for closet or recessed installations. It is
approved for bathroom, bedroom and bed-sitting room installa-
tions and is suitable for mobile homes. The natural gas model
is suitable for installation in a mobile home that is permanently
positioned on its site and fuelled with natural gas.
This insert must be recessed into a vented noncombustible
wood-burning fireplace (prefabricated or masonry) only. The
minimum fireplace opening size in which the heater is to be
installed is:
HEIGHT 21.75" WIDTH 28" DEPTH 18"
The minimum allowable chimney flue size is 6" round.
The minimum distance, from the bottom of a combustible
mantle projecting 3" maximum from the wall to the top of the
louvre opening, is 12".

The glass is 3/16" ceramic glass available from your Napoleon
/ Wolf Steel Ltd. dealer. DO NOT SUBSTITUTE MATERIALS.
Clean the glass after the first 10 hours of operation with a
recommended gas fireplace glass cleaner. Thereafter clean
as required. DO NOT CLEAN GLASS WHEN HOT! If the glass
is not kept clean permanent discolouration and / or blemishes
may result.
THIS GAS FIREPLACE INSERT SHOULD BE INSTALLED AND
SERVICED BY A QUALIFIED INSTALLER to conform with local
codes. Installation practices vary from region to region and it is
important to know the specifics that apply to your area,
for example: in Massachusetts State:
• The fireplace damper must be removed or welded in the open
position prior to installation of a fireplace insert or gas log.
• The appliance off valve must be a “T” handle gas cock.
• The flexible connector must not be longer than 36 inches.
• The appliance is not approved for installation in a bedroom or
bathroom unless the unit is a direct vent sealed combustion
product.
• A carbon monoxide detector is required in all rooms containing
gas fired appliances.
• WARNING: This product must be installed by a licensed plumber
or gas fitter when installed within the commonwealth of
Massachusetts.
In absence of local codes, install to the current CAN1-B149 Instal-
lation Code in Canada or to the National Fuel Gas Code, ANSI
Z223.1, and NFPA 54 in the United States. Mobile home instal-
lation must conform with local codes or in the absence of local
codes, install to the current standard for gas equipped mobile
housing CAN/CSA Z240 MH Series in Canada or ANSI Z223.1 and
NFPA 54 in the United States.
Purge all gas lines with the glass door of the fireplace insert
opened. Assure that a continuous gas flow is at the burner
before closing the door.
Under extreme vent configurations, allow several minutes (5-
15) for the flame to stabilize after ignition.
Objects placed in front of the fireplace must be kept a minimum
of 48" away from the front face of the unit.
The fireplace insert and its individual shutoff valve must be discon-
nected from the gas supply piping system during any pressure testing
of that system at test pressures in excess of 1/2 psig (3.5 kPa). The
fireplace insert must be isolated from the gas supply piping system
by closing its individual manual shutoff valve during any pressure
testing of the gas supply piping system at test pressures equal to or
less than 1/2 psig (3.5 kPa).
A 1/8 inch NPT plug, accessible for test gauge connection, must be
installed immediately upstream of the gas supply connection to the
fireplace insert.
The fireplace insert must be electrically connected and grounded in
accordance with local codes. In the absence of local codes, use the
current CSA C22.1 CANADIAN ELECTRICAL CODE in Canada or
the ANSI/NFPA 70 NATIONAL ELECTRICAL CODE in the United
States. The blower power cord must be connected into a properly
grounded receptacle. The grounding prong must not be removed
from the cord plug.

Minimum inlet gas supply pressure is 4.5 inches water col-
umn for natural gas and 11 inches water column for propane.
Maximum inlet gas pressure is 7 inches water column for
natural gas and 13 inches water column for propane. Manifold
pressure under flow conditions is 3.5 inches water column for
natural gas and 10 inches water column for propane. When
the fireplace is installed at elevations above 4,500ft, and in the
absence of specific recommendations from the local authority
having jurisdiction, the certified high altitude input rating shall
be reduced at the rate of 4% for each additional 1,000ft.
